Understanding Your Needs
Before choosing an IVF clinic, it is important to understand your specific needs. Do you have a known fertility issue, such as endometriosis or male factor infertility? Are you of advanced maternal age? Do you have a history of failed IVF cycles? These are all important factors that can impact the success of your IVF treatment. It is also important to consider any personal preferences you may have, such as the location of the clinic, the type of treatment they offer, and the overall atmosphere of the clinic.
Researching Success Rates
One of the most important factors to consider when selecting an IVF clinic is their success rates. This refers to the percentage of live births resulting from IVF procedures performed at the clinic. It is important to note that success rates can vary greatly between clinics and can also be influenced by different factors such as age, type of infertility, and previous IVF attempts. When researching success rates, it is important to look at the clinic’s overall success rates as well as their success rates for patients with similar backgrounds and needs as yours.
Specialties and Treatment Options
IVF clinics often have different specialties and treatment options available. Some clinics may specialize in treating specific types of infertility, while others may offer a wide range of treatment options such as genetic testing, egg freezing, and donor egg/sperm programs. It is important to choose a clinic that aligns with your specific needs and offers the best treatment options for your situation. This will increase your chances of success and provide you with the best possible care.

Cost and Insurance Coverage
IVF treatment can be expensive, so it is important to consider the cost of treatment and whether your insurance covers any of the costs. Some clinics may offer payment plans or financial assistance programs to help make treatment more affordable. It is also important to ask about the costs associated with additional services, such as medication and genetic testing, to avoid any unexpected expenses.
